Boss Fight Prep
Before leaving the ship, let’s do a bit of prep work. Do you have all the Full-Life magic you want? If your average party level is 30, you’ll be able to draw some soon, so if you want to transfer some away from your current party, this is a good time to do so. Make sure your team can draw, then save your game in the far right cargo bay of the Ragnarok. When you’re ready to move on, exit the ship using the cargo bay one screen to the right of the cockpit.
As soon as you get out, you will be forced to battle Raijin and Fujin again. First off, draw as much Full-Life as you can get from Fujin. If your characters aren’t a high enough level, she may only have Cura. GF AbilityReplaces Attack with a stealing attack. Learned by Diablos and Bahamut. a ItemGF learns Str+40% ability from Raijin and ItemFully restores abnormal status and HP to all members Useful chain: buy 10 Elixirs at Esthar Shop!!!, then use Med LV Up to make 1 Megalixir. from Fujin. When you are finished drawing and mugging, go ahead and take them out. After the battle (I mean RIGHT after) make sure to junction to your newfound wealth of Full-Life. I think it works best as status protection. Also, Ultima as an Elem-Def junction renders your characters IMPERVIOUS to any elemental attack!

Take out left and right (after mugging them) to eliminate his most powerful attacks. Then go after the main body.
When that battle is over, you have a chance to switch your junction before the next battle. Since you can draw Aura in the next battle, I like to transfer any Aura I have on my current party to my reserve party members to free up some space, and of course make sure everyone has the Draw ability junctioned.
